I had some free time, so I put together this small step-by-step walkthrough for those that want to get into the chat room with Trillian. Take a look:
Creating an IRC connection.
1. Load up Trillian and open the "Preferences" window.
2. Choose "Connections," the second option on the left side of the screen.
3. Choose to "Add a new Connection" and click "IRC" in the menu that appears.
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v494/Pumster/Trillian/trill1.jpg
4. For the first line, "Server Alias," type in "PSINext."
5. For the next line, you have to choose your Server. If you are in the US, type in "irc.coderx.net." If you are in Europe, type in "irc.speedis.org."
6. Fill in the information in the remaining three boxes, including your "Nickname" and "Username." The names you choose will be displayed to other users, so choose wisely.
Creating an Account.
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v494/Pumster/Trillian/trill2.jpg
7. Click on the White Sphere icon, which represents your IRC connection(s). Click on "Show Status Window."
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v494/Pumster/Trillian/trill3.jpg
8. Click on the Text Box and type in "/msg nickserv register PASSWORD your@email.com." Replace "PASSWORD" with the password you want. Replace "your@email.com" with your own e-mail address. Your e-mail address must be valid so you can activate your account.
Entering the Chat Room.
Once you receive your "Activation E-Mail" and follow the instructions, you can enter the chat room. This can be done by typing in "/join #psp" in the Text Box on the "Status Window" screen. However, to automatically log into your account and even join the PSINext chat room when you start Trillian, follow these instructions.
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v494/Pumster/Trillian/trill4.jpg
9. Click on the White Sphere icon and choose "Connection Preferences."
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v494/Pumster/Trillian/trill5.jpg
10. Click on the "Miscellaneous" tab at the top of the window.
http://img.photobucket.com/albums/v494/Pumster/Trillian/trill6.jpg
11. Go to the "Perform Buffer" option and type in "/msg nickserv identify PASSWORD." Replace "PASSWORD" with the password you chose earlier.
12. If you want to log into the PSINext chat room automatically, you have to type in an additional command. To do so, you must separate commands by typing in a semicolon (";") into the Text Box. Next, type in "/join #psp."
Congratulations! You can now enter the PSINext chat room!
